Fenerbahçe had to accept a defeat against Olympiacos. In Greece, Ismael Kartal's team lost 3-2 due to goals from Konstantinos Fortounis, Stefan Jovetic and Chiquinho. Dusan Tadic and Irfan Can Kahveci then gave Fenerbahçe a much more hopeful starting position. Jayden Oosterwolde was injured before half time with what appeared to be a serious knee injury. The return of the Conference League quarter-final takes place in a week.

Ayoub El Kaabi was Olympiacos' deepest striker. The Moroccan was supported at his back by Jovetic. Fenerbahçe also had some big names at the kick-off. Edin Dzeko was the designated man to ensure the Turkish goals and Tadic, Oosterwolde and Sebastian Szymanski were also on tap. Ferdi Kadioglu started on the bench, but would come on for Oosterwolde before half time.

Dzeko got the first chance to silence the fanatical Greek supporters. A smooth counter-attack led to Tadic's possession on the left, where the Serbian passed Dzeko well. The striker tried with a nice volley, but had to watch as centre-back David Carmo stuck out his foot and prevented the ball from flying towards the far corner. Moments later, Dzeko managed to score a shot on goal, to which goalie Konstantinos Tzolakis had an answer.

Olympiacos proved particularly effective in the subsequent phase. Caglar Söyüncü took far too long to get away and saw his pass touched by Georgios Masouras. The ball landed perfectly at the feet of Fortounis, who tried his luck with a clean shot into the far corner: 1-0. Olympiacos came into the match better after that goal and became dangerous through Carmo, who saw Dominik Livakovic make a good save.

Livakovic was beaten for the second time moments later. Fortounis seemed to be preparing to shoot, but instead had a wonderful through ball to Jovetic. The Montenegrin was not offside due to Söyüncü's late step and finished in the short corner: 2-0. Fenerbahçe came close twice in the closing stages of the first half. First of all, Kahveci shot a free kick just wide, a little later Rade Krunic met Tzolakis.

Just after the break, another defensive error created another excellent opportunity for Olympiacos. El Kaabi regained possession and, after a cutting move, came face to face with Livakovic, who prevented the Moroccan from scoring. Fenerbahçe did not learn from its mistakes and again suffered childish loss of ball. This time Miha Zajc simply surrendered, allowing Chiquinho to continue and finish in the far corner: 3-0.

Fenerbahçe had little to show for it, although Szymanski should have made it 3-1. Kahveci brought the ball to the Pole, who missed an opportunity by heading wide. Kahveci later claimed a handball from Chiquinho in the box in the next dangerous moment, but his protests went nowhere. Moments later, the Turks were awarded a penalty after a clumsy tackle by Panagiotis Retsos on Bright Osayi-Samuel. Tadic scored the penalty flawlessly: 3-1.

The diptych was completely revived twenty minutes before the end. Kadioglu passed from the left to Szymanski, who made a very clever pass to Kahveci. The Turkish international remained calm and worked the ball into the far corner: 3-2. At the other end, Carmo soon had a great opportunity to head the ball, which he squandered by heading over. Thus, the initiative remained with Fenerbahçe, which almost leveled through Szymanski. The ex-Feyenoord player shot just wide. Olympiacos held out and will travel to Istanbul next week with a minimal lead.
